Application Materials and Checklist

Applications are accepted on a rolling basis until April 15, 2013.

Please email all submissions to ivriyon@jtsa.edu.

Materials needed:

  1. Ivriyon application form (fill out the form and send it as an attachment to ivriyon@jtsa.edu)
  2. Curriculum vitae
  3. Personal statement: a one- to two-page statement that explains your reasons for applying to the program
  4. Statement from your school head or principal supporting your application and presenting the school's commitment to Hebrew
  5. Letter of reference from a colleague or supervisor
  6. An application fee of $50 is due with the application and should be submitted online, or mailed by check, made out to JTS/Ivriyon, to the address below.
  7. Upon acceptance to the program, a registration fee of $100 is due by May 6, 2013 and should be submitted online, or mailed by check, made out JTS/Ivriyon, to the following address:

A Hebrew proficiency test and a phone interview with a member of the JTS Hebrew Language faculty will take place soon after the application and the registration fee have been submitted.
